    Top Sources for Live Pasadena News

    Finding reliable sources for live Pasadena news is key to staying well-informed. Several local news outlets provide real-time coverage. Pasadena Now is a great option; they offer up-to-the-minute reporting on everything from city council meetings to local events. The Pasadena Star-News is another excellent resource, providing in-depth coverage of local issues and breaking news. For broadcast news, local channels like KTLA 5 and ABC7 often cover Pasadena stories as part of their regional coverage. Don't forget about social media! Platforms like Twitter can be invaluable for quick updates, especially during breaking news events. Follow local reporters, news outlets, and city officials to get real-time information. Remember to cross-reference information from multiple sources to ensure accuracy. These various channels will help you get a comprehensive view of what's happening in Pasadena right now. Whether it's a community event, a traffic incident, or an important announcement from City Hall, having these resources at your fingertips will keep you in the loop and ready to respond.

    Pasadena Community Events: Staying in the Loop

    Staying in the loop about Pasadena community events is a fantastic way to connect with your neighbors and experience everything our city has to offer. Local news websites like Pasadena Now and the Pasadena Weekly are excellent resources for finding event listings. They often have comprehensive calendars that include everything from farmers' markets to concerts to community meetings. Social media is another great tool for discovering events. Follow local organizations, businesses, and community groups on platforms like Facebook and Instagram to stay updated on their activities. The City of Pasadena's official website also has an events calendar that includes city-sponsored events and important public meetings. Don't forget to check out local libraries and community centers, which often host free or low-cost events for residents of all ages. Sign up for email newsletters from your favorite organizations to receive regular updates on their upcoming events. By using these various resources, you'll never miss out on the exciting happenings in Pasadena, and you'll be able to fully participate in our vibrant community.
